What to Expect at Each Stop

Old Town Square (Staromestske namesti)

This is the heart of Prague, bustling and historic. Meeting here provides a perfect start point, with plenty of iconic architecture like the Astronomical Clock. The photographer will ask about your ideas, and you can decide whether to focus on the square’s historic charm or venture elsewhere. The review mentions this as a great starting spot, and its lively atmosphere makes for dynamic photos.

Charles Bridge

Walking across this historic bridge is like stepping into a postcard. You’ll love the views of the city skyline and the castle. Expect to spend around 20 minutes here, capturing both wide shots and more intimate moments. The bridge’s Gothic towers and statues make for fantastic backdrops.

Lennon Wall

This colorful graffiti wall offers a pop of vibrancy and meaning. It’s a favorite among travelers for its artistic vibe and political symbolism, making your photos lively and expressive. It’s a quick stop but well worth the visit.

Franz Kafka Museum Area

You won’t go inside the museum, but the area around it offers lovely views over the Vltava River and Charles Bridge. Expect relaxed, artsy photos here, with the river and architecture as your backdrop.

Waldstein Palace Gardens

A bit more secluded, these gardens feature peacocks, lush greenery, and classical architecture. It’s a quiet, picturesque spot perfect for natural, relaxed photos. The gardens also have impressive murals and views of the city.

Prague Castle

Spanning a large area, the castle provides a majestic setting for photos. You’ll explore the exterior, capturing the grandeur of the buildings, courtyards, and fortifications. The guide limits the walk to accessible, non-ticketed areas, so you won’t miss out on the best views or need extra tickets.

Practical Considerations

Private Prague Photoshoot for Individuals, Couples and Families - Practical Considerations

Duration and Group Size: The shoot lasts between 1 and 3 hours, depending on your pace and interests. It’s designed for small groups or individuals, with a maximum of four people. This intimacy allows for more personalized attention and relaxed sessions.

Weather Dependence: The provider states that good weather is necessary. If the weather turns bad, they offer the option to reschedule or get a full refund, which is reassuring.

Cost and Additional Expenses: The price covers photography and digital delivery, but not transportation, food, drinks, or prints. If you want physical copies or want to explore further afield, those would be extra.

Accessibility: Most travelers can participate, and service animals are allowed. The meeting point is conveniently located near public transportation, making it easy to access.
